A theory of change for healing


This guide enables understanding of what elements need to be in place to achieve real social change for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people living with trauma. It emphasises the importance of nurturing healing leadership and promoting trauma awareness as crucial first steps towards individual, family and community healing.

Northern Territory of Australia: the shame of Indigenous female incarceration


This paper attempts to explore why there has been a continual rise in Indigenous female incarceration rates in the Northern Territory since the Royal Commission into Aboriginal Deaths in Custody (RCIADIC) in 1991.

Links between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ander culture and wellbeing: what the evidence says


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ples believe there to be a strong link between culture, health and wellbeing. This report explores what has been written about these links. This report highlights the complicated links between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ander culture and wellbeing which operate at the individual and/or community level.

The Elders’ report into preventing Indigenous self-harm and youth suicide


This report brings together the voices of Elders and community leaders from across affected communities that wished to speak publicly about the causes and solutions needed to address this issue of Indigenous self-harm and youth suicide.

National strategic framework for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ples’ mental health and social and emotional wellbeing 2017-2023

The National Strategic Framework for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Peoples’ Mental Health and Social and Emotional Wellbeing (2017-2023) sets out a comprehensive and culturally appropriate stepped care model that is equally applicable to both Indigenous specific and mainstream health services.
